Recovery of Debts and Bankruptcy Act, 1993

Section - 36 - Power to make rules

Power to make rules .

36 . (1) The Central Government may, by notification, make rules to carry out the provisions of this Act.

(2) Without prejudice to the generality of the foregoing powers, such rules may provide for all or any of the following matters, namely :-

(a)- the salaries and allowances and other terms and conditions of service of [the Chairpersons,] the Presiding Officers, Recovery Officers and other officers and employees of the Tribunal and the Appellate Tribunal under sections 7, 12 and 13;
(b)- the procedure for the investigation of misbehaviour or incapacity of [the Chairpersons of Appellate Tribunals and the Presiding Officers of the Tribunals] under sub-section (3) of section 15;
